Abstract

There is provided a position and orientation measurement apparatus, information processing apparatus, and an information processing method, capable of performing robust measurement of a position and orientation. In order to achieve the apparatuses and method, at least one coarse position and orientation of a target object is acquired from an image including the target object, at least one candidate position and orientation is newly generated as an initial value used for deriving a position and orientation of the target object based on the acquired coarse position and orientation, and the position and orientation of the target object in the image is derived by using model information of the target object and by performing at least once of fitting processing of the candidate position and orientation generated as the initial value with the target object in the image.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A position and orientation measurement apparatus comprising:
 one or more processors; and   a memory coupled to the one or more processors, the memory having stored thereon instructions which, when executed by the one or more processors, cause the apparatus to:   acquire, from an image including a target object, a plurality of coarse positions and orientations of the target object;   determine a resolution of the plurality of coarse positions and orientations of the target object;   generate, based on the resolution of the plurality of coarse positions and orientations, a predetermined number of initial candidate positions and orientations including at least one set of position and orientation which is different from any of the acquired coarse positions and orientations; and   derive the position and orientation of the target object in the image by associating model information of the target object with respective positions and orientations of the predetermined number of generated initial candidate positions and orientations.
